Thanks Peter,
That was exactly the issue.
Upon looking for it in the Maui Admin Guide, I noticed that the
ENABLEMULTIREQJOBS parameter is documented in the html
(http://www.adaptivecomputing.com/resources/docs/maui/a.fparameters.php)
but not in the PDF version
(http://www.adaptivecomputing.com/resources/docs/maui/pdf/mauiadmin.pdf).

> Hi Robert,
>
> Do you have the following line in your maui config?
>
> ENABLEMULTIREQJOBS TRUE
>
> I believe it is require to request multiple resources.

> Hello,
>
> We're running Maui with Torque on our cluster (10 nodes, 8 cores each).
> When I submit a job on multiple nodes specifying them in a certain why my
> job gets blocked by Maui, otherwise it runs just fine.
>
> Here's the line I usually use in submission script to submit jobs to
> mutliple nodes (say if I need 16 cores): "#PBS -l nodes=2:ppn=8". That works
> just fine.
>
> But when I don't need a multiple of 8 processors and don't want to block
> processors unnecessarily, I tried the following (say to get 20 cores):
> "#PBS -l nodes=2:ppn=8+1:ppn=4"
> According to the Torque user manual that should get me 16 cores on 2 nodes
> and 4 cores on the third. I can submit it without a problem, but then it is
> blocked by Maui.
> For testing I also tried "#PBS -l nodes=1:ppn=1+1:ppn=1" and "#PBS -l
> nodes=1:ppn=8+1:ppn=8", which are blocked as well
>
> Output from showq for the blocked job:
> ================================================================
> BLOCKED JOBS----------------
> JOBNAME USERNAME STATE PROC WCLIMIT
> QUEUETIME
> 1272 robert BatchHold 1 00:00:30 Tue Mar 29
> 18:06:47
> ================================================================
>
> The relevant policies (as far as I know), which are set in maui.cfg, are:
> NODEACCESSPOLICY SHARED
> JOBNODEMATCHPOLICY EXACTNODE
>
> Please, can anybody point me to where the problem might be? If there are
> queue specific settings that could cause this, I'd be more than happy to
> provide more information.
>
> Thanks,
> Robert
>
> PS: I am aware that I could just reserve multiple of 8 processors and let
> some of them sit idle, but on our relatively small cluster that amounts to s
> significant waste of resources.
